Steve and Erin Brown

Steve grew up in a Jewish home with a deep desire to know God, but he was strongly opposed to Jesus and the Christian faith. During his first two years of college, he joined the local Hillel club to explore Judaism. Despite his strong desire to find God in his Jewish roots, it never fully felt complete, and something was missing.

Then, on November 1st, 1998, during his junior year of college, God began to open his eyes. That’s when he met his amazing wife, Erin. At first, he was very resistant and closed to the gospel. He even told her he would never believe it, but she explained that he didn’t yet know the power of her God, and she was right.


In 2005, he felt called to attend Grace Chapel Indio and was baptized later that year. He became a member and went on to serve as a high school youth leader. He now regularly leads Thursday night men’s Bible studies and seasonal community groups.
Steve has a passion to equip the local church by exalting Jesus Christ and drawing hearts to a devoted love and obedience through the teaching of God’s Word. He desires to shepherd God’s people to know, experience, and share the love of Christ that surpasses knowledge. When Steve is not studying, you will find him running, hiking, or mountain biking with his wife.
